You Will Have a Chance to Stay Busy and Feel Involved

If your current job is boring, you will likely feel much different about having a job in supply chain management because there are many routine responsibilities you will have. As a supply chain manager, you are going to need to spend time talking with partners of the company you are working with to ensure that the company has everything it needs to successfully run the business, including materials that may be used to make products and materials that are used to ship those products out. You may need to make sure everything is ordered on a routine basis, keep track of inventory, and even negotiate with these suppliers to get the best deals.
